Output 83d37e09d54fc7a186b8a33abcd2d8b8990a18eb944220a735c83e7361510b0f:5

value
647290188
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9372e1a52d41d3d3d9eaeb4176a0fb34715ddb5f OP_EQUALVERIFY OP_CHECKSIG
address
1ESdxJRzAhjm7Jjr2XWbST63R6QRi9DcJd
transaction
83d37e09d54fc7a186b8a33abcd2d8b8990a18eb944220a735c83e7361510b0f
spent
true